Output 68f31357a1c9c475ec6a960050a988fae635275a56eac0f1ae8576c963d44866:1

value
2907700
script pubkey
OP_0 OP_PUSHBYTES_20 77a70be32433fc0f16cb13f3150d911c0aec705f
address
ltc1qw7nshceyx07q79ktz0e32rv3rs9wcuzljkme4h
transaction
68f31357a1c9c475ec6a960050a988fae635275a56eac0f1ae8576c963d44866
spent
true